How does microneedling mesotherapy remove discoloration?
The treatment involves controlled micro-puncturing of the skin – fine needles create micro-injuries that initiate an intense regeneration process and accelerate skin renewal. At the same time, active ingredients are introduced through micro-channels, including depigmenting peptides, vitamin C, tranexamic acid, and niacinamide, which brighten the skin from within.
Mechanism of action of microneedling mesotherapy:
- Micro-punctures stimulate cell regeneration and skin exfoliation
- Active ingredients penetrate deeply into the skin without damaging the hydrolipid barrier
- Melanin overproduction is inhibited, and accumulated pigment is dispersed
- The skin regains uniform coloration and better structure
- The effects are gradual but visible after the first treatments
Depending on the chosen technology (Nanopore, Dermapen, nano treatments), the appropriate penetration depth and depigmenting ampoules are selected.
When is it worth getting microneedling mesotherapy for discoloration?
We recommend the treatment especially for individuals who:
- have noticed pigmentation spots after sun exposure or in tanning beds
- are dealing with hormonal discoloration (e.g., melasma)
- have marks from acne (PIH - post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ation)
- want to brighten their skin and improve its texture
- are looking for a skin rebuilding method without lasers or invasive procedures
The treatment can be performed throughout the year - even in summer, provided SPF50 photoprotection is used.

What to combine with to enhance the effects?
To achieve even better brightening and skin tone evening results, it is recommended to combine microneedling mesotherapy with other treatments:
- IPL Photorejuvenation
→ selectively acts on melanin, breaking down deeply deposited pigment
→ recommended interval: minimum 2-3 weeks between treatments
- PRX-T33 or Retix.C Peeling
→ enhances exfoliation effect and accelerates skin renewal
→ alternating treatments every 2-3 weeks
- INDIBA® Deep Care for the face
→ supports tissue regeneration and oxygenation after micro-punctures
→ can be combined in the same week - before or after, with a 2-3 day gap
When not to combine treatments?
Avoid combining microneedling mesotherapy with:
- strong peels or IPL on the same day
- photosensitizing therapies
- active inflammatory skin conditions or infections
- right after sun exposure - the skin needs to calm down
